Position Overview:
As an Estimator at Prime Design Homes, you will be responsible for preparing accurate and comprehensive cost estimates for residential construction projects. Your expertise in quantity takeoffs, cost analysis, and industry knowledge will contribute to the successful bidding and profitability of projects. You will collaborate closely with the project management, design, and procurement teams to ensure that estimates align with project requirements and meet client expectations.

Responsibilities:

1. Cost Estimation and Analysis:

  • Review architectural plans, specifications, and project scope to understand project requirements.
  • Perform quantity takeoffs and material quantity calculations to determine the quantities needed for construction projects.
  • Research and analyze current market prices for labor, materials, and equipment to accurately estimate costs.
  • Prepare detailed cost estimates, including labor, materials, subcontractor costs, permits, and other project-related expenses.
  • Collaborate with suppliers and subcontractors to obtain competitive pricing for materials and services.
  • Continuously update and maintain a comprehensive database of cost estimates, prices, and industry trends.

2. Bid Preparation and Documentation:

  • Develop and submit timely and competitive bids for residential construction projects.
  • Prepare comprehensive bid packages, including cost breakdowns, schedules, and proposal documentation.
  • Collaborate with the procurement team to evaluate subcontractor bids and negotiate contracts.
  • Coordinate with the project management team to ensure bid requirements are met and proposals align with project objectives.
  • Participate in pre-bid meetings and site visits to gather accurate project information and assess potential risks or challenges.

3. Collaboration and Communication:

  • Work closely with the project management, design, and procurement teams to understand project goals and specifications.
  • Collaborate with architects, engineers, and subcontractors to address cost-related queries and provide value engineering suggestions.
  • Maintain effective communication channels with stakeholders, providing regular updates on cost estimates and bid statuses.
  • Participate in project meetings to provide insights on cost implications and potential value engineering opportunities.
  • Liaise with clients during the estimation process, addressing any cost-related questions or concerns.

4. Cost Control and Analysis:

  • Monitor and analyze project costs throughout the construction phase, comparing actual costs to estimated costs.
  • Identify cost-saving opportunities and value engineering solutions without compromising quality or project requirements.
  • Collaborate with the project management team to assess and manage change orders, ensuring accurate cost adjustments.
  • Generate reports and analysis on project costs, variances, and trends, providing insights for future estimation improvements.
  • Maintain all cost data in our database as well as all selection, design, and estimating software
